Inviting Young Adults To A Unique Mission Experience In Houston Texas!

The Vincentian Summer Mission is an invitation to spend time seeing what Christ sees and actually working to meet the needs of the poor while finding ways to end the cycle of poverty within our city; within our own lives. It is an invitation to experience simplicity and service as a lifestyle, a source of life just like the air we breathe!

While on mission in Houston Texas, you will live in our St. Vincent de Paul Village with other Vincentians on mission as well. You will spend the day at our different ministry locations– working at our food pantries, experiencing the home visits, rebuilding furniture, helping with the summer program for the children in the Village, distributing food and helping at the central office.
